136 – Releasing Two Rockthorns at the Same Time

For the guillemot eggs, Kosto wobbled towards the cave atop the Flower immediately after the swimming lesson was concluded. When they got near the cave, they could clearly see the cave's appearance. It wasn't big. After all, the ridge wasn't tall. The flat entrance resembled a gaping maw.

It wasn't deep either, its interior could be clearly seen at a glance.

With the telescope in hand, Kosto saw it particularly clearly: “Oh, heavens! There are bones!” He saw decaying human remains along with some worn-out stuff and even a boat wreckage lying inside the cave.

“Drop the anchor!”

“Release the canoe!”

He screamed and made preparation to take the canoe to see what was going on inside the cave.

……

The castle, near the black nightshade.
Liszt was inspecting his black nightshade.
“It's about to be born, Mr. Carter, my ninth sprite worm is about to be born.” He stroked the big budding flower. With Magic Eyes released, he could clearly see light blue magic power gathering towards a particular flower, where the black nightshade sprite worm gestated, from the leaves of the black nightshade.

“Favored by the glory of knights indeed! We all thought that it wouldn't make it, yet it did. Master, according to Mr. Gort, you are a child of glory. I firmly believe that it is the case! It was your glory that shone on the black nightshade sprite!”

“Perhaps, or I'm really lucky.”

The term child of glory was equivalent to the term ‘Wen Qu Star incarnate' on Earth. Liszt didn't know if he was a child of glory, or a child of something else. The smoke mission brought him beyond extraordinary luck, which was probably the ‘favor of the glory of knights'.[1]

He wasn't too concerned about this and just instructed indifferently: “Make sure that it's often looked after, and notify me right away once the black nightshade sprite worm is born.”

“Please rest assured. The castle's servingmen will check on the black nightshade once per hour.” Replied Carter.

“By the way, is it time to feed Stupidwoman?”

“It was almost one o'clock in the afternoon when we set off, it should be indeed its feeding time by now.”

“Then let's go back first.”

After returning to the castle, he took Tremblingwoods and some servants, and went to feed the bitch.

The Violent Dog Stupidwoman's iron cage was already set up, it was placed 500 meters away from the castle. With the iron cage as the center, the foundation for a 3-meter-tall wall was being excavated 20 meters away. In order to prevent Stupidwoman from breaking out, a tilted baffle was also going to be installed atop the wall.

Currently, Stupidwoman had not eaten for three days.

Only when Liszt came to inspect it, would he have the servants feed it some water so that it didn't die of thirst.

“Uh!” When it saw people coming over, Stupidwoman, which had been lying on the ground, feebly climbed onto its paws. It stared daggers at Liszt and company. Clearly, its fierceness hadn't been curbed yet.

“Woof woof!” Tremblingwoods darted forward and started circling the iron cage while wagging its tail and calling at Stupidwoman. It was very enthusiastic.

Stupidwoman, on the other hand, didn't reciprocate the enthusiasm. It turned its head to stare back at Tremblingwoods and kept issuing growls.

“The feeder hasn't been delivered yet?” Liszt looked at the cage and asked Thomas, who followed behind him, “Even the stakes haven't been laid yet, its too slow.”

The feeder was a feeding device specially designed for Stupidwoman.

After all, Stupidwoman was not Tremblingwoods, it could injure one at any time. In order to prevent this, it was kept in a cage. It had to be fed as it couldn't be left to die. Therefore, a feeding device was designed to send food into the iron cage from outside the wall via a rope.

At the same time, the iron cage could be moved. Once feces accumulated in the cage, the cage would be drawn away along with Stupidwoman, before being drawn back after the ground was cleaned.

Although it appeared complicated, but in fact, it was very simple. It was a simple application of several ropes.

For his future Violent Dog army, Liszt was very careful when formulating this design.

“It has no magic power. It turns out that even if it's a magic beast, it also can't condense magic power when it's starved.” Mused Liszt.

Half of a magic beast's magic power was produced on its own, while the other half was absorbed from the outside world.

However, when starved, not only couldn't it produce magic power on its own, but it also had no strength to absorb magic power from the outside world. Thus, the importance of nutrition regarding cultivation could be perceived.

“Thomas, feed it water.”

“Yes, Master.” Thomas carefully moved to beside the Violent Dog's iron cage with a bucket in hand. Even though he had already done this quite a few times, but he still couldn't help but to tremble.

“Uh uh!” Stupidwoman increased the volume of its growls.

Thomas' hands shook violently and half of the ladle of water was spilt. When he extended the ladle into the cage, Stupidwoman reached out with her head, and he spilt the rest of the water.

He lowered his head and hurriedly apologized: “Sorry, Master.”

“Continue. Stupidwoman is no longer able to release its magic, it's now equivalent to a wild dog. Remember this.”

“Yes, Master.”

The second time, Thomas finally managed to pour the water into the basin without a hitch. Stupidwoman roared for a while. Seeing that it could no longer scare Thomas, it began to drink the water.

When Stupidwoman finished drinking, Tremblingwoods was already whirling anxiously outside the cage.

Having tasted the forbidden fruit, it yearned for more.

Liszt coughed: “Thomas, open the side cage.” There were two iron cages, one was for Stupidwoman to dwell in and the other was for Tremblingwoods to enter through.

Fearing that Stupidwoman could escape, the iron cages could be joined together before opening the cage door.

Because it had already done it once yesterday, Tremblingwoods very naturally got into the small iron cage, which was then pushed towards the door of the big iron cage by Thomas and the other servingman. Next, the door was opened and the two iron cages were joined together. Tremblingwoods quickly rushed inside, pounced on Stupidwoman, and began to hump.

The three-day-starved Stupidwoman had no strength to resist.

Everything was over half an hour later.

Stupidwoman was left lying inside the cage, looking absentmindedly at the meshed sky and the white clouds leisurely drifting in the horizon.

Tremblingwoods, on the other hand, was full of vigor, gamboling in the horse field. Every day, it would come to get a slice of heaven.

Its body was getting sturdier, which could be perceived every day. Its muscles were no longer that swelled. It gradually recovered the normal figure of a Violent Dog. It looked a bit streamlined. However, it had already surpassed an adult tiger in terms of height and length.

Its magic power was also rising, and it was capable of releasing 45 Rockthorns per day.

Liszt felt more and more that there was hope for Tremblingwoods to evolve into a mid-ranked magic beast. Therefore, its meals were also getting better and better, short of giving it magic beast meat. It was tantamount to feeding it gold coins. Per day, Tremblingwoods ate at least seven times as much as Liszt.

“At least one gold coin per day. Tremblingwoods, you can't betray my hopes.” Thought Liszt aloud before issuing an order, “Tremblingwoods, release your magic!”

“Woof!”

While running, Tremblingwoods subconscious issued a call and released its magic.

Thud! Thud! Two Rockthorns simultaneously pierced out of the ground in front of it.

“What? It released two Rockthorns at the same time?" Liszt was quite surprised when he saw that two Rockthorns were released at the same time. This was equivalent to a completely new kind of magic.

Only mid-ranked magic beasts could release multiple kinds of magic!

Without giving Liszt time to come back to his senses, the butler Carter's voice came from behind: “Master, Captain Kosto asked to see you. He claims to have found a treasure in a cave near the dock site.”
